Discover Impactful Work

At this site, we offer customers a complete range of high-end analytical instruments and software services that support customers within proteomics, clinical research, forensic toxicology, pharmaceutical, biotech, food safety, and environmental market segments. We build market-leading Mass Spectrometry solutions to help our customers advance science. Our products are designed with a customer-oriented mindset to shape the lab of the future by accelerating innovation, developing state-of-the-art technologies, and delivering end-to-end solutions.

As part of the Tribrid Mass Spectrometer Research and Development team, you will contribute to the design and development of technologies critical to supporting Thermo Fisher Scientific's position as the leader in mass spectrometry.

A Day in the Life
  • Conduct leading-edge research and development in the field of mass spectrometry to develop novel technologies to be used with our Quadrupole, Ion Trap and Orbitrap mass analyzers
  • Investigate and explore new ideas and concepts by defining experiments, building, debugging and characterizing prototype instruments in order to verify proof of principle
  • Test and verify new products and product improvements
  • Maintain substantial knowledge of state-of-the-art principles and theories, contributing to scientific literature and conferences

Keys to Success

Education

Bachelor's degree with 5 years of experience; or Master's degree with 2 years of experience; or PhD in Physics, Chemistry, Engineering, or related science

Experience
  • Practical knowledge of high vacuum systems, ion optics, quadrupole, ion trap and Orbitrap analyzers
  • Solid programming skills (Python, Lua, C#, C++)
  • Strong communication and presentation skills
  • Capable of working with multi-disciplinary teams
  • Ability to travel internationally (10%)

Preferred
  • 3+ years of experience working in the field of mass spectrometry, preferably in an R&D capacity within an academic or industry setting, designing and developing analytical instrumentation
  • Experience with ion activation techniques
  • Experience with RF ion trap devices
  • Experience in the analysis of mass spectrometry data
  • Experience with real time instrument control
  • Ability to troubleshoot electronic circuits and instrumentation
  • Working knowledge of ion trajectory simulation and/or fluid dynamics software (SIMION, Comsol Multiphysics, ANSYS)
